New Cnc/Mazak/ machine integration mirroring the Fagor/Mitsubishi FTP pattern: MazakConnectionConfig, IMazakFtpClient, MazakFtpClient, MazakMachine (ICncMachine). Transfers EIA/ISO G-code text over FTP to Smooth-family controllers. Mazatrol CMT (proprietary binary) out of scope. Design (verified against Mazak Matrix EIA manual + field reports): - Filenames preserved verbatim; no O#### rename, no extension append. - Symmetric ResolvePath for Read/Write/Delete (avoids ISS-020 class; Delete resolved too, unlike copied Mitsubishi source). - Validator = full passthrough for Mazak (EIA permits ';' EOB, '[ ]', '#'; restrictive Fanuc checks would false-reject valid programs). - Port 21 default, -porta=23 for Smooth Ai IIS variant. - ProgramDirectory site-specific, no default.
